### sec.134 Other evidentiary aids
A certificate purporting to be signed by the police commissioner and stating any of the following matters is evidence of the matter—
a stated document is a thing as follows given, issued, kept or made under this Act—
an appointment, authorisation, approval or decision;
a direction, notice or requirement;
a stated document is a copy of a document mentioned in paragraph (a) ;
on a stated day and at a stated time a disaster situation started;
on a stated day and at a stated time a disaster situation ended;
on a stated day, or during a stated period, either of the following was, or was not, in force for a stated person—
an authorisation for the person to exercise declared disaster powers;
an authorisation for the person to exercise rescue powers;
on a stated day, a stated person was given a stated notice or direction under this Act;
on a stated day a stated requirement was made of a stated person.
s 134 amd 2014 No. 17 s 45 ; 2024 No. 22 s 92 sch 1
